Job description

The Information Security Specialist is responsible for Information Security within the Americas region. Duties include designing, implementing, and improving security controls, incident response strategies, and risk mitigation measures to safeguard IT systems and sensitive data., * Designs and implements security solutions to protect IT infrastructure

  • Develops and enforces security policies, standards, and risk mitigation strategies
  • Conducts penetration testing, vulnerability scanning, and security audits
  • Investigates and responds to security incidents, performing forensic analysis
  • Ensures compliance with regulatory frameworks (GDPR, NIS2, ISO 27001)
  • Evaluates and integrates new security tools and technologies
  • Automates security processes and threat mitigation where possible
  • Works with IT, DevOps, and risk management teams
  • Engages with regulatory bodies and compliance auditors
  • Coordinates with external cybersecurity partner

Requirements

  • Education and Experience: Bachelor's deg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Science, Information Technology or related discipline and 4 years of IT experience focused on Information Security relevant technologies; or combination of equivalent education, training, certification, and 8 years relevant experience. Information Security certifications (such as CISSP: Certified Information Systems Security Professional; CEH: Certified Ethical Hacker; CISM: Certified Information Security Manager; GIAC: Global Information Assurance Certification) can be accepted in lieu of bachelor's degree. Security+ preferred.
  • Knowledge of Information Security engineering principles (least privilege, zero trust)
  • Knowledge of IAM solutions (Active Directory, Okta, SSO, MFA)
  • Knowledge of threat modeling and risk analysis techniques
  • Knowledge of Information Security automation tools (Ansible, PowerShell, Python)
  • Knowledge of Compliance frameworks (NIST CSF, CIS Controls, ISO 27001)
  • Skilled in designing and implementing security architectures
  • Skilled in automating security processes and threat mitigation
  • Skilled in managing security operations and improving response efficiency
  • Ability to work independently and take ownership of security initiatives
  • Strong problem-solving skills in high-pressure situations
  • Excellent teamwork and collaboration in cross-functional security projects
  • Clear and concise communication to bridge technical and non-technical audiences
  • Travel domestically and internationally occasionally.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a valid driver license and passport.

Many Opportunities., In line with its international growth, Liebherr's venture into the United States began in 1970. Within a couple of years, the company expanded and completed its production facilities in Newport News, Virginia, for its product line of hydraulic excavators. It was later converted into Liebherr's manufacturing facility for mining trucks and remains home to Liebherr Mining Equipment Newport News, Co. In addition to its production facility, Liebherr markets a wide variety of products and technologies through its companies located across the United States. The companies are Liebherr-Aerospace Saline, Inc., Liebherr Gear Technology, Inc., Liebherr Automation Systems, Co., and Liebherr USA, Co., the umbrella company for 12 product segments that are positioned across the United States.
